        특성도를 이용한 결측치 대체방법

        김형주,김동재,Kim, Hyungju,Kim, Dongjae 한국통계학회 2017 응용통계연구 Vol.30 No.3

        임상시험에서 어떻게 결측치를 다룰 것인가 하는 것은 큰 문제이다. 주로 주분석에서 사용하는 ITT원칙은 결측치가 어떠한 메커니즘을 따른다는 가정 하에 결측치를 대체 하지만 가정에 대한 타당성이 불확실한 문제가 있다. 즉, 올바른 결측치 대체방법은 매우 중요하다. 본 연구에서는 Kang과 Kim (1997)이 제안한 일치도와 유지도의 개념을 이용하여 새로운 결측치 대체방법을 제안하였다. 또한 실제자료를 이용하여 예제를 제시하고 Monte Carlo 모의실험을 통하여 기존방법과 대체 성능을 비교하였다. How to handle missing data is a main issue in clinical trials. We impute missing data based on missing data that follows a mechanism according to the intention-to-treat rule. However, using the right imputation method for missing data is very important because this supposition is unclear. We suggest a new imputation method for missing data using agreement and maintenance introduced by Kang and Kim (1997). We give an example and adapt a Monte Carlo simulation to compare the performance between the established method and the suggested method.

        미생물을 이용한 대마의 리그닌과 펙틴 분해

        김형주,권길광,서규원,김민철,김형섭,고준석,Kim, Hyung-Joo,Kwon, Kil-Koang,Seo, Kyu-Won,Kim, Min-Chul,Kim, Hyung-Sup,Koh, Joon-Seok 한국섬유공학회 2009 한국섬유공학회지 Vol.46 No.6

        In this study, microbial degradation of lignin and pectin in raw hemp was investigated. Using lignin and pectin containing media, various microorganisms were isolated from soil and fecal samples of ruminant. The isolates were identified using the 16s rRNA method. The isolated strains were Klebsiella sp., E. coli, Aspergillus fumigatus, and Burkholderia sp. For the degradation of hemp, a pre-cultured isolate was inoculated (5% v/v) into the medium containing raw hemp (as a sole carbon source: 1% w/v) and nitrogen sources and the mixture was incubate aerobically for 168 hours in a shaking incubator (200 rev $min^{-1}$) at $30^{\circ}C$. The hemp biodegradation activity of the identified microorganism was measured by FT-IR. The FT-IR results showed that the Klebsiella sp. has the highest lignin and pectin degradation activity. These results show that the isolates and the reaction conditions could be applied to the conventional hemp fiber refinery processes.

      • 리튬 유황전지용 폴리우레탄 고분자 전해질의 전기화학적 특성

        김형주,신준호,김종화,김기원,안효준,안주현,Kim, Hyeong-Ju,Shin, Joon-Ho,Kim, Jong-Hwa,Kim, Ki-Won,Ann, Hyo-Jun,Ahn, Ju-Hyun 한국전기화학회 2002 한국전기화학회지 Vol.5 No.2

        본 연구에서는 높은 인장강도와 탄성력을 가지는 다공성 폴리우레탄(polyurethane, PU)을 지지체(matrix)로 이용하고, 유기 전해액 ethylene carbonate(EC), propylene carbonate(PC), tetraethylene glycol dimethylether(TG)와 1M $LiCF_3SO_3$를 부피비 1:1 비율로 혼합하여 액체 전해액을 제조하였으며, 높은 이론용량을 가지는 Li/S전지에 적용하여 전기 화학적 특성을 조사하였다. 1M $LiCF_3SO_3$에 TG를 첨가할 경우 유기 전해액의 함침량이 약 $750\%$ 증가하였으며 방전용량$(1065mAh/g{\cdot}sulfur)$ 및 사이클 특성이 가장 우수하였다. 1M $LiCF_3SO_3$에 TG/EC(v/v,1:1) 및 PC/EC(v/v,1:1)를 첨가한 경우 이온 전도도는 각각 $3.15\times10^{-3}(S/cm)$ 와 $3.18\times10^{-3}(S/cm)$로 나타났다. Polyurethane was used as matrix for polymer electrolytes with liquid electrolyte consist of organic solvent as ethylene carbonate(EC), propylene carbonate(PC), and tetraethylene glycol dimethylether(TG) and 1M $LiCF_3SO_3$, which has high mechanical strength and porosity. Electrochemical properties fur polyurethane electrolytes with various liquid electrolytes were evaluated. The amount of immersed liquid electrolyte for TG with 1M $LiCF_3SO_3$ was increased to about $750\%$ by weight, and initial discharge capacity and cycle performance was better than others. Ionic conductivity for TG/EC(v/v,1:1) and PC/EC(v/v, 1:1) with 1M $LiCF_3SO_3$ was about $3.15\times10^{-3} S/cm, \;3.18\times10^{-3}S/cm$

      • Siewert 분류에 의한 협의의 분문부 위암(type II)과 분문하 위암(type III)의 검토

        김형주,권성준,Kim Hyoung-Ju,Kwon Sung Joon 대한위암학회 2004 대한위암학회지 Vol.4 No.3

        Purpose: To determine the clinical value of the Siewert classification for gastic-cancer patients in Korea, we evaluated and compared the clinicopathologic factors of type II and type III cancer. Materials and Methods: The medical records of 89 consecutive patients who had undergone surgery for an adenocarcinoma of the gastroesophageal junction (GEJ) at the Department of Surgery, Hanyang University Hospital, between Jun. 1992 and Dec. 2003 were reviewed retrospectively. Results: There were one patient with type I, 12 pateints with type II and 77 patients with type III. During the same period, 1,341 patients underwent surgery for a gastric carcinoma, so proportion of GEJ cancer being $6.6\%$. The median followup duration was 31 months (range: $2\∼135$ months), and the follow-up rate was $100\%$. Between type II and type III cancers, there were no significant differences in the clinicopathologic variables including age, sex, gross appearance, histologic type, depth of invasion, and pathologic stage. The longest diameter of the tumor was larger in type III ($6.1\pm2.1$ cm) than in type II ($3.9\pm1.1$ cm)(P=0.001). A total gastrectomy with Roux-en-Y esophagojejunostomy was done most frequently, while jejunal interposition was done in 3 cases of type II and 2 cases of type III. More than a D2 lymphadenectomy was done all cases. The numbers of dissected lymph nodes and metastatic lymph nodes in type II were 43.8 and 5.8 respectively, while they were 49.8 and 8.1 in type III, but the difference between the two groups were not statistically significant. The mean length of the proximal resection margin was $15\pm5$ mm in type II and $21\pm13$ mm in type III, but this difference was not statistically significanct. The time to recurrence after operation was 19.3 months in type II and 16.9 months in type III. The five-year survival rates of type II and III were $68.8\%\;and\;52.7\%$ respectively, but difference was not significant. Conclusion: There were no significant differences in the clinicopathologic variables, including survival rate, between type II and type III cancers in Korean patients According to these findings, it appears to be reasonable to classify type III cancer as a cardia cancer in a broad sense.

        상류 후류의 익렬 유동에 미치는 영향에 대한 실험적 연구

        김형주,조강래,주원구,Kim, Hyeong-Ju,Jo, Gang-Rae,Ju, Won-Gu 대한기계학회 2001 大韓機械學會論文集B Vol.25 No.3

        This paper is concerned with the effect of cylinder wakes upstream on blade characteristics of compressor cascade(NCA 65 series). At first, it is found that the velocity defect ratio of cylinder wake varies according to the acceleration and deceleration in a flow field but, is conserved nearly constant at flow downstream the cascade, irrespective of the flow path in the cascade. When a cylinder wake flows along near the suction surface of the blade, or impinges on the leading edge, the turbulent velocities are supplied on or inside the outer edge of boundary layer near the leading edge of suction surface, and the transition to a transitional or turbulent boundary layers is induced, so that the laminar separation is prevented, but the profile loss increases. The transition of boundary layer to a transitional or turbulent one is strongly related with the strength of added turbulent velocities near the leading edge on the suction surface, which is influenced by the flow path of a cylinder wake.

        보리 잎과 옥수수 수염의 혼합과 유산균 발효를 이용한 γ-aminobutyric acid 생산 증진

        김형주,윤영걸,Kim, Hyung-Joo,Yoon, Young-Geol 한국유기농업학회 2017 韓國有機農業學會誌 Vol.25 No.1

        GABA는 glutamic acid decarboxylase에 의해서 L-glutamic acid가 탈탄산화되어 생합성된 비단백질 아미노산이다. GABA는 식물에서 스트레스에 대항한 대응반응으로 생성된다. 사람의 중추신경계에서는 주요 억제성 신경전달물질 중 하나로 항고혈압, 항당뇨 효능이 있다고 알려져 있다. 본 연구에서 우리는 보리 잎과 옥수수 수염을 유산균과 함께 발효함으로써 GABA 생성을 증진시키고자 하였다. 보리 잎과 옥수수 수염을 다양한 무게 비율로 조합하여 혼합하였고, $30^{\circ}C$에서 48시간 동안 배양기 안에서 L. plantarium과 함께 발효시켰다. 발효된 혼합물을 열수 추출한 후, thin layer chromatography와 GABase assay를 이용하여 GABA의 생산을 분석하였다. 우리는 9:1 혼합발효추출물이 다른 비율의 추출물 보다 GABA 함량이 높은 것을 확인하였는데 이것은 혼합과 발효기술이 보리 잎과 옥수수 수염 내 GABA 양 증진에 효과가 있음을 의미한다. 또한 몇 가지 생리활성을 분석한 결과 혼합발효추출물의 항산화 효능이 비발효 추출물에 비하여 증진되었고 세포독성은 나타나지 않음을 확인하였다. 이러한 결과는 보리 잎과 옥수수 수염의 조합과 이것을 유산균과 함께 발효시키는 방법이 고함량의 GABA와 증진된 생리 활성을 지닌 기능성 식품으로서의 개발 가능성이 있음을 의미한다. ${\gamma}$-aminobutyric acid (GABA) is a non-proteinogenic amino acid biosynthesized through decarboxylation of L-glutamic acid by glutamic acid decarboxylase. GABA is believed to play a role in defense against stress in plants. In humans, it is known as one of the major inhibitory neurotransmitters in the central nervous system, exerting anti-hypertensive and anti-diabetic effects. In this report, we wanted to enhance the GABA production from the barley leaf and corn silk by culturing them with lactic acid bacteria (LAB). The barley leaf and corn silk were mixed with various weight combinations and were fermented with Lactobacillus plantarum in an incubator at $30^{\circ}C$ for 48 h. After extracting the fermented mixture with hot water, we evaluated the GABA production by thin layer chromatography and GABase assay. We found that the fermented mixture of the barley leaf and corn silk in a nine to one ratio contained a higher level of GABA than other ratios, meaning that the intermixture and fermentation technique was effective in increasing the GABA content. We also tested several biological activities of the fermented extracts and found that the extracts of the fermented mixture showed improved antioxidant activities than the non-fermented extracts and no indication of cytotoxicity. These results suggest that our approach on combining the barley leaf and corn silk and its fermentation with LAB could lead to the possibility of the development of functional foods with high levels of GABA content and improved biological activities.

        무선 센서 네트워크환경에서 헤드 경험정보를 이용한 에너지 효율적인 클러스터 헤드 선정 알고리즘

        김형주,김성철,Kim, Hyung-Jue,Kim, Seong-Cheol 한국정보통신학회 2009 한국정보통신학회논문지 Vol.13 No.3

        In wireless sensor networks, there are hundreds to thousands of small battery powered devices which are called sensors. As sensors have a limited energy resources, there is a need to use it effectively. A clustering based routing protocol forms clusters by distributed algorithm. Member nodes send their data to their cluster heads then cluster heads integrate data and send to sink node. In this paper we propose an energy efficient cluster-head selection algorithm. We have used some factors(a previous cluster head experience, a existence of data to transmit and an information that neighbors have data or not) to select optimum cluster-head and eventually improve network lifetime. Our simulation results show its effectiveness in balancing energy consumption and prolonging the network lifetime compared with LEACH and HEED algorithms. 무선 센서 네트워크에서는 노드들이 제한적인 에너지를 가지고 있기 때문에 효율적인 에너지 사용이 요구된다. 클러스터링 방식은 클러스터를 형성하고 클러스터 멤버 노드들이 전송한 데이터를 클러스터 헤드가 병합하여 싱크 노드로 전송하는 방식을 사용한다. 본 논문에서는 무선 센서 네트워크 환경에서 클러스터 헤드를 효율적인 선정하는 알고리즘을 제안한다. 제안하는 알고리즘은 노드 자신의 과거 헤드 경험의 세분화와 전송할 데이터의 존재 여부, 전송할 데이터를 보유하고 있는 이웃 노드들의 정보를 이용하여 헤드를 선정 함으로 네트워크 전체의 수명을 증가시킨다. 시뮬레이션을 통하여 기존의 방식인 LEACH, HEED 알고리즘에 비해 밸런싱 있는 에너지를 소모하고, 더 나은 네트워크 수명을 보장함을 보였다.

        사회적 기업가정신에 대한 사회적 자본의 매개효과가 사회적 성과에 미치는 영향

        김형주,전인오,Kim, Hyung-Ju,Jeon, In-Oh 한국벤처창업학회 2017 벤처창업연구 Vol.12 No.5

        The purpose of this study is to examine whether the social capital supported by social enterprises play a role in ensuring self-sustaining and sustainable growth, and to examine whether the mediating effect of social capital have a central effect on social performance. The results of this study are as follows: Innovation and orientation-to-social-value of social entrepreneurship have positive effects on structural capital, and positive influence on cognitive capital and relational capital, but innovation only has no effect. In addition, social entrepreneurship is partially mediated by structural capital. In the mediating effect between social entrepreneurship and cognitive capital, only the risk-taking and the orientation-to-social-value have a partial mediation effect on cognitive capital. However, only the initiative of relational capital was found to have a full mediating effect. And social capital has a positive effect on social performance as a whole. In conclusion, considering that the realization of economic purpose and other social purpose of social enterprises will help to develop and create jobs in the local community, and that they are engaged in business activities in a poor management environment, to provide policy support for inducing high value-added industries through industry-specific collaborations.
